Key Elements of Effective Website Design


Creating an effective website design involves more than just choosing attractive colors and fonts. It requires a strategic approach that considers various elements to ensure a cohesive and functional user experience. One of the key components is a clear and intuitive navigation structure. Visitors should be able to find what they are looking for quickly and easily, without having to sift through cluttered pages. This means organizing your content logically and providing clear pathways to important information, such as contact details, product listings, and service descriptions.


Another essential element is responsive design. With the increasing use of mobile devices, it's imperative that your website looks and functions well on all screen sizes. A responsive design adapts to different devices, providing a seamless experience whether visitors are using a smartphone, tablet, or desktop computer. This not only improves user satisfaction but also boosts your search engine ranking, as Google prioritizes mobile-friendly websites in its search results.


Visual elements, such as images, videos, and graphics, also play a crucial role in effective website design. High-quality visuals can capture attention and convey your brand's story in an engaging way. However, it's important to strike a balance between aesthetics and functionality. Overloading your site with too many visuals can slow down loading times and distract from your core message. By carefully selecting and optimizing visual content, you can create a visually appealing website that enhances the user experience without compromising performance.

Understanding Your Target Audience in Swindon


To create a website that truly resonates with your audience, it's essential to understand who they are and what they need. This involves conducting thorough research to identify the demographics, preferences, and behaviors of your target market. Are they young professionals looking for trendy cafes and boutiques? Or are they families in search of local services and community events? By gaining insights into your audience, you can tailor your website design to meet their specific needs and expectations.


One effective way to understand your target audience is to create buyer personas. These are fictional representations of your ideal customers, based on real data and research. Each persona should include details such as age, occupation, interests, and pain points. By keeping these personas in mind throughout the design process, you can ensure that your website speaks directly to the people you want to attract. For example, if your target audience values convenience and speed, you might prioritize a streamlined design with quick access to key information.


Engaging with your audience through surveys, social media, and community events can also provide valuable insights. Listening to their feedback and observing their interactions with your current website can reveal areas for improvement and new opportunities. By staying attuned to the needs and preferences of your audience, you can create a website that not only attracts visitors but also keeps them coming back. In a dynamic market like Swindon, understanding your audience is key to staying relevant and competitive.


Local SEO Best Practices for Website Design


Search engine optimization (SEO) is a critical aspect of website design that can significantly impact your online visibility. For local businesses in Swindon, implementing local SEO best practices is essential to attract nearby customers who are searching for your products or services. One of the first steps in local SEO is to claim and optimize your Google My Business listing. This free tool allows you to manage how your business appears in Google search results and maps, making it easier for potential customers to find you.


Incorporating local keywords into your website content is another effective strategy. These are specific phrases that people in Swindon might use when searching for your offerings. For example, a bakery in Swindon might use keywords like "best cakes in Swindon" or "Swindon bakery near me." By including these terms in your page titles, meta descriptions, and content, you can improve your chances of ranking higher in local search results. Additionally, creating location-specific content, such as blog posts about local events or partnerships with other Swindon businesses, can further boost your local SEO efforts.


Another important aspect of local SEO is building local backlinks. These are links from other reputable websites in Swindon that point to your site. They signal to search engines that your business is trusted within the local community. You can earn local backlinks by collaborating with local influencers, participating in community events, or getting featured in local news outlets. By focusing on these local SEO best practices, you can enhance your website's visibility and attract more customers from the Swindon area.

Mobile Responsiveness: Why It Matters


In today's mobile-driven world, ensuring that your website is mobile responsive is more important than ever. Mobile responsiveness refers to a website's ability to adapt its layout and content to fit different screen sizes and devices. With a significant portion of web traffic coming from smartphones and tablets, a mobile-friendly design is essential for providing a positive user experience. Visitors who encounter a site that is difficult to navigate on their mobile devices are likely to leave quickly, leading to higher bounce rates and lost opportunities.

Moreover, mobile responsiveness is a key factor in search engine rankings. Google uses mobile-first indexing, meaning it primarily considers the mobile version of a site when determining its search ranking. If your website is not optimized for mobile, it could negatively impact your visibility in search results, making it harder for potential customers to find you. By prioritizing mobile responsiveness, you can improve your search engine performance and attract more visitors to your site.

To achieve mobile responsiveness, it's important to use a responsive design framework that automatically adjusts your website's layout based on the device being used. This includes flexible grids, scalable images, and touch-friendly navigation elements. Additionally, testing your site on various devices and screen sizes can help you identify and address any issues that may arise. By ensuring that your website provides a seamless experience across all devices, you can enhance user satisfaction and drive better results for your Swindon business.


Showcasing Local Culture and Community in Your Design


Integrating local culture and community into your website design can create a strong connection with your audience and differentiate your business from competitors. Swindon is a town rich in history and culture, and reflecting this in your website can resonate with local customers and foster a sense of belonging. One way to achieve this is by incorporating local imagery, such as photos of iconic landmarks, events, or recognizable scenes from around town. These visuals can evoke a sense of familiarity and pride, making your site more relatable to the local audience.

Another approach is to highlight your involvement in the community. This could include showcasing partnerships with other local businesses, featuring testimonials from local customers, or promoting community events and initiatives. By demonstrating your commitment to Swindon, you can build trust and loyalty among residents who value supporting local enterprises. Additionally, sharing stories about your business's history and its role in the community can add a personal touch that resonates with visitors.

Content that reflects local interests and values can also enhance your website's appeal. This might involve creating blog posts, videos, or social media updates that discuss local topics, such as upcoming events, local news, or cultural highlights. Engaging with your audience through content that speaks to their experiences and interests can foster a deeper connection and encourage repeat visits. By integrating local culture and community into your website design, you can create a unique and engaging online presence that stands out in Swindon.
